Chrome can’t load block extensions fast enough

Reported by chj2...@gmail.com, Yesterday (34 hours ago)

Issue description

Chrome OS Version: <Version-71.0.3578.94: Chrome is official build
Device name: Lenovo N23 chromebook
<b>Network info: <network, encryption type, router model (if known)></b>

Please specify Cr-* of the system to which this bug/feature applies (add
the label below).

Steps To Reproduce:
(1)remove domain account
(2)add account back
(3)quickly goto website that is normally blocked 

Expected Result:website would be blocked

Actual Result: chrome can’t load the policy’s with the proxy.pac from the extension

How frequently does this problem reproduce? (Always, sometimes, hard to
reproduce?)

Sometimes

What is the impact to the user, and is there a workaround? If so, what is
it?

Impact to the company trying to block users from accessing specific website content

Comment 2 by mef@google.com, Today (12 hours ago)

Components: Internals>Network>Proxy
I'm not sure whether net stack can do anything here if policy is not available, but tentatively adding Proxy tag as description explicitly mentions proxy.pac

Comment 3 by eroman@chromium.org, Today (11 hours ago)

Labels: Needs-Feedback
Please give more detail on what steps (1) and (2) mean.

Also by "extension" do you mean a Chrome extension?

Is the setup that you are pushing Policy to Chrome users that load a particular Chrome Extension, and that Chrome extension in turn is controlling the proxy settings to configure a PAC script?

If so this is an extension/policy issue.
